1998 Tennessee Oilers

What was the record of the 1998 Tennessee Oilers?

The Tennessee Oilers finished the regular season with a 8-8 record. They went 3-5 at home and 5-3 on the road.

What division did the 1998 Tennessee Oilers play in?

The 1998 Tennessee Oilers played in the Central Division of the American Football Conference.

What was the division record of the 1998 Tennessee Oilers?

During the regular season, the 1998 Tennessee Oilers went 7-1 against their AFC Central opponents.

What was the 1998 Tennessee Oilers record against each of their divisional opponents?

Opponent Record Win Percentage % Point Differential
Cincinnati Bengals 2-0 100% +39
Pittsburgh Steelers 2-0 100% +19
Baltimore Ravens 2-0 100% +6
Jacksonville Jaguars 1-1 50% -2

What was the 1998 Tennessee Oilers record by month?

The 1998 Tennessee Oilers had their best month in October, when they went 2-1 and had a 66.7% win percentage. Their worst month was September, when they went 1-3 and had a 25% win percentage.

Month Record Win Percentage % Point Differential
September 1-3 25% -13
October 2-1 66.7% +31
November 3-2 60% +5
December 2-2 50% -13

Did the 1998 Tennessee Oilers make the Playoffs?

No, the Oilers didn't make the Playoffs in 1998.

What was the point differential for the 1998 Tennessee Oilers?

The Tennessee Oilers finished the regular season with a point differential of +10. Based on their point differential and their pythagorean expectation, the Oilers could have been expected to have about 8.3 wins, or a 8-8 record in the regular season.

How did the 1998 Tennessee Oilers perform in one-score games?

In close, one-score games, the 1998 Tennessee Oilers went 3-5. In games decided by a field goal or less, the Oilers went 2-2.

How did the 1998 Tennessee Oilers perform in overtime games?

The 1998 Tennessee Oilers did not play any overtime games in the regular season.

What was the longest win streak for the 1998 Tennessee Oilers?

The longest win streak during the regular season for the 1998 Tennessee Oilers was a 3 game winning streak.

What was the longest losing streak for the 1998 Tennessee Oilers?

The longest losing streak that the Tennessee Oilers had during the 1998 regular season was 3 games, which happened once during the season.
